How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Carlstadt?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Carlstadt Studio Apartments | $2,264 | $1,790 | $3,089 |
| Carlstadt 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,343 | $1,374 | $3,700 |
| Carlstadt 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,064 | $1,750 | $5,125 |
| Carlstadt 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,078 | $2,400 | $3,919 |
| Carlstadt 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,858 | $2,900 | $5,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Carlstadt
How much are Studio apartments in Carlstadt?
There are currently 277 Studio Apartments in Carlstadt with rent ranges from $1,790 to $3,089 with an average price of $2,264.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Carlstadt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Carlstadt ranges from $1,374 to $3,700 with an average monthly rent of $2,343.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Carlstadt c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Carlstadt range from $1,750 to $5,125.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,064.
How expensive are Carlstadt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 87 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Carlstadt on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,400 to $3,919 - averaging $3,078 for the location.
